Output 11873566415982ab4d8660cbf6cb6e7b24f9634340ece8021b373139566faec3: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26a5b5362f895a70216cc6690084c810e4ac82c5 OP_EQUALVERIFY OP_CHECKSIG
address
14XMBsf41w5h6XjicAChdTdSjUuHyy5UVf
transaction
11873566415982ab4d8660cbf6cb6e7b24f9634340ece8021b373139566faec3
spent
true